What is Vextra?

Vextra is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that allows AI assistants like Claude, Cursor, and VS Code to server based on model context protocol that processes and parses design files (vextra/figma/sketch/svg), enabling ai assistants to access and manipulate design content.

A server based on Model Context Protocol that processes and parses design files (Vextra/Figma/Sketch/SVG), enabling AI assistants to access and manipulate design content.

Quick Config Preview

{ "mcpServers": { "vextra-mcp-server": { "command": "npx", "args": ["-y", "vextra-mcp-server"] } } }

Add this to your claude_desktop_config.json or .cursor/mcp.json
